As the Office Manager for the Ambulatory Monitoring and Diagnostics Business, you will be responsible for all office management activities, including safety related tasks, and supporting requests for our staff of R&D and Contract Manufacturing as well as supporting the local team in the San Diego Office. You will be part of the R&D team for Electrocardiogram (ECG) Solutions, reporting to the Head of R&D ECG/ Site Leader for the San Diego office.

The pay range for this position in San Diego, CA is $93,000 to $158,000. The actual base pay offered may vary depending on multiple factors including job-related knowledge/skills, experience, business needs, geographical location, and internal equity.
In addition, other compensation, such as an annual incentive bonus, may be offered. Employees are eligible to participate in our comprehensive Philips Total Rewards benefits program, which includes a generous PTO, 401k (up to 7% match), HSA (with company contribution), stock purchase plan, education reimbursement and much more.
At Philips, it is not typical for an individual to be hired at or near the top end of the range for their role and compensation decisions are dependent upon the facts and circumstances of each case.
